Drainfields

Caring for your drainfield is a must and involves both some care and some common sense. Here are few things that you should do to maintain your drainfield:

  • Plant only grass over and near your septic system. Roots from nearby trees or shrubs might clog and damage the drainfield.
  • Don't drive or park vehicles on any part of your septic system. Doing so can compact the soil in your drainfield or damage the pipes, tank, or other septic system components.
  • Keep roof drains, basement sump pump drains, and other rainwater or surface water drainage systems away from the drainfield. Flooding the drainfield with excessive water slows down or stops treatment processes and can cause plumbing fixtures to back up.

Cost Savings

No stone or geotextile is typically required, and chamber installations use less pipe. Installations are faster so you save on heavy equipment operation and eliminate the need for heavy trucks used to transport stone.

Less Site Disruption

Since Infiltrator chambers typically occupy a smaller total area than stone and pipe leachfields, and use less heavy equipment, there is less damage to property and landscaping. Elimination of stone means easier cleanup at the job site.

Superior Technology

  • A solid top prevents infiltration of rainwater
  • Sidewall louvers allow lateral leaching and evapotransporation
  • An inspection port cutout permits monitoring and maintenance
  • Patented chamber interlocks with an advanced design connect chambers end-to-end with a precise fit
  • Advanced contouring connections allow chambers to avoid obstacles
  • Open bottom provides unobstructed soil interface, allowing up to 50% reduction in trench length
